Understanding Electrical Panels

The electrical panel, often called a breaker box, is the central distribution point for electricity in a home. Power from the utility company enters your house through this panel, which splits the electricity into separate circuits for lighting, outlets, and major appliances. Built-in circuit breakers or fuses protect each circuit from drawing too much current, which can cause overheating or even a fire. A modern electrical panel will also include clear labeling, making it easier to identify and isolate any malfunctioning circuits during emergencies.

Common Safety Hazards

Safety risks increase when panels are outdated, installed improperly, or become overloaded. Homes built before the 1990s may still use panels that do not meet today’s safety standards. For example, certain brands, such as Federal Pacific and Zinsco, have a documented history of failing to trip during overload conditions, allowing hazardous conditions to go unchecked. These failures may lead to electrical arcing, melted circuits, and, in worst-case scenarios, house fires.

Signs Your Panel Needs Attention

Several warning signs may indicate that your electrical panel is due for a professional check or replacement:

  • Breakers trip frequently, sometimes without an obvious cause
  • Lights flicker or dim, especially when larger appliances turn on
  • There is a persistent burning odor or the sound of crackling from the panel area
  • Obvious wear, such as excessive warmth, rust, or dark scorch marks around the panel

Ignoring these signals can lead to costly and dangerous consequences, such as electrical fires or damage to home electronics. Staying alert to these symptoms can make a crucial difference in preventing emergencies.

Importance of Regular Inspections

Routine electrical safety inspections are critical for identifying hazards before they become serious issues. Professional electricians assess whether circuits are overloaded, check for frayed or outdated wiring, and test the reliability of safety mechanisms inside the panel. For most homes, a full inspection every three to five years is recommended, with greater frequency for older properties or those that have undergone renovations.

Upgrading to Modern Panels

Upgrading to a modern electrical panel can significantly improve safety and better accommodate the power needs of contemporary households. Newer panels support higher amperage, necessary for energy-hungry appliances such as air conditioners and electric vehicles. Modern upgrades often feature advanced safety technologies, including Arc-Fault Circuit Interrupters (AFCIs) and Ground Fault Circuit Interrupters (GFCIs), which provide enhanced protection against shocks, short circuits, and electrical fires. Homeowners planning remodels or adding new appliances should factor in the benefits of a panel upgrade when evaluating long-term property safety.

Compliance with Electrical Codes

Electrical codes are developed to reflect the latest research and standards on residential electrical safety. Homeowners need to ensure that panel installations or upgrades comply with current regulations to remain safe and eligible for home insurance coverage. For example, the 2023 revision of the National Electrical Code requires specific safety devices, such as whole-home surge protectors, on new or replacement panels. Non-compliance not only threatens resident safety but may also trigger legal and insurance complications in the event of an electrical incident. Always work with licensed professionals who stay up to date with local and national requirements.

Protecting Against Power Surges

Power surges, whether caused by lightning, utility grid fluctuations, or large appliances cycling on and off, can inflict severe damage on sensitive electronics and household infrastructure. Installing a whole-home surge protector as part of your electrical panel setup is an effective way to protect your property and appliances. Surge protections help absorb or redirect unwanted voltage spikes, extending the lifespan of everything from computers to kitchen appliances. This precaution is especially important in regions prone to storms or frequent grid instability.
